Previously known as The Family, a project initiated by Prince after the success of the movie Purple Rain, but now calling themselves fDeluxe, band members St. Paul Peterson, Jellybean Johnson, Susannah Melvoin and Eric Leeds return with a new album of pure funk.

Their only album, titled The Family, released in 1985 on the Paisley Park/Warner label spawned a top 10 R&B hit ('Screams Of Passion') and introduced 'Nothing Compares 2 U' which was famously covered by Sinead O'Connor. Their debut CD became a cult classic and its influence has been cited by numerous artists from R&B acts like Rahsaan Patterson to legends including Paul McCartney and Robert Palmer. 2011 Grammy Winner Questlove of The Roots says that it is one of the most unheralded funk records of all time (GQ).

Now, after many years, the band is back, though, due to a variety of differences with their former mentor Prince, they can no longer use The Family name. The very best of the Minneapolis & LA music scene came together for the album, among them 2010 Emmy winners and extended family Wendy & Lisa (Wendy being Susannah's twin), as well as Ricky Peterson, Doyle Bramhall (Eric Clapton), Oliver Leiber, and Charley Drayton (Xpensive Winos, Fiona Apple).
